Sindbad~EG File Manager
�
TԚg;* � � � d dl Z d dlZd dlZd dlZd dlZd dlZd dlZd dlmZ ej e
ed� � d� � ej ej dk d� � G d� dej
� � � � � � Z ej e
ed� � d� � ej ej dk d� � G d � d
e� � � � � � Z ej e
ed� � d� � ej ej dk d� � G d� de� � � � � � Z ej e
ed� � d� � ej ej dk d� � G d
� de� � � � � � Zedk r ej � � dS dS )� N)�support�killzTest requires os.kill�win32zTest cannot run on Windowsc �r � e Zd ZdZdZd� Zd� Zdd�Zd� Zd� Z d� Z
d � Zd
� Zd� Z
d� Zd
� Zd� Zd� Zd� Zd� ZdS )� TestBreakN� c � � t j t j � � | _ | j �&t j t j | j � � d S d S �N)�signal� getsignal�SIGINT�_default_handler�int_handler��selfs �5/usr/local/lib/python3.11/unittest/test/test_break.py�setUpzTestBreak.setUp sE � � &� 0��� ?� ?�����'��M�&�-��)9�:�:�:�:�:� (�'� c � � t j t j | j � � t j � � t
j _ d t
j _ d S r
) r r
r �weakref�WeakKeyDictionary�unittest�signals�_results�_interrupt_handlerr s r �tearDownzTestBreak.tearDown s>